40 St Paul’s

Cocktail Bars in Birmingham
Cocktail Bars in Birmingham – 40 St Paul’s

Voted the Best Cocktail Bar in Birmingham 2019 by Independent Birmingham, this excellent moody venue had to make the list. It is an ideal cocktail bar for a gin lover as it specialises in gin cocktails, but its menu has a cocktail to suit anyone. Celebrating a special occasion? Why not book a gin tasting session or a taster of ‘Gin, Chocolate, and Cheese?’ It sounds like a winning combo to me.

Address: 40 Cox St, Birmingham B3 1RD

Aluna

Aluna is located at the beautiful Canalside in The Mailbox, a place to escape the norm and experience some extraordinary cocktails. Aluna offers a vast range of cocktails, including signature drinks that come Instagram-ready to your table, cocktail trees to share with all your friends, and large sharers from a cauldron. Is all that a bit too much? Don’t worry; they also serve classic cocktails such as the espresso martini, sour, or zombie.  

If you want an extra special weekend treat, book a bottomless brunch and enjoy delicious food and a few too many cocktails.

Address: 128-130, The Mailbox, Wharfside St, Birmingham B1 1RQ

Couch

Cocktail Bars in Birmingham
Cocktail Bars in Birmingham – Couch

Couch is a neighbourhood cocktail bar for enjoying cocktails in a relaxed and casual setting. Put away the pretension of cocktail culture and have a laid-back experience here. Their cocktail menus change every 6 months and have fun themes inspired by TV. This bar was voted one of the top 20 bars to visit in the world by The Telegraph, so if you’re looking for cocktail bars in Birmingham, make sure this one makes your list.

Address: 1466 Pershore Rd, Stirchley, Birmingham B30 2NT

Dirty Martini

Cocktail Bars in Birmingham
Cocktail Bars in Birmingham – Dirty Martini

Dirty Martini has a quirky and fun vibe with its funky cocktails, making it a great spot to take photos of your cocktails and enjoy them. Of course, you can look forward to a wide range of martinis served in various flavours. Dirty Martini offers 12 martini varieties, from Espresso to Mango and Chili. Martinis, is that not your thing? They also offer a wide range of gin, tequila, rum, and vodka cocktails to suit you.

Address: 7 Bennetts Hill, Birmingham B2 5ST

Jukeboxers

Cocktail Bars in Birmingham
Cocktail Bars in Birmingham – Jukeboxers

Dance, drink, and dine the night away with this quirky take on a cocktail bar. Jukeboxers hosts live music throughout the night from a set of pianos duelling on stage. Other instruments and lovely vocals also join the fray at certain times, and the talented staff take on requests to ensure you can hear your favourite songs while tasting your favourite cocktails.

Address: Unit 1, Arena, Birmingham B1 2AA

Kilo Ziro

Cocktail Bars in Birmingham
Cocktail Bars in Birmingham – Kilo Ziro

This café and bar are helping out the planet and supporting ethical businesses around Birmingham and beyond. They even offer a range of cocktails made from a local garden patch, reducing food waste and giving you a creative new cocktail with seasonal produce. They also offer zero-waste cocktail classes and live music in the bar. What’s not to love?

Address: 1 Gibb St, Deritend, Birmingham B9 4BF
